The Art of Chinese CalligraphyChinese calligraphy is an art form that has been practiced for thousands of years. It involves using a brush and ink to write Chinese characters on paper or silk. Calligraphy is not just writing, but an art form that requires skill, patience, and creativity.Chinese calligraphy has a deep cultural significance. It is not only a means of communication, but also a way to express one's thoughts and emotions. Calligraphy is an important part of traditional Chinese culture and is highly respected.There are many different styles of Chinese calligraphy, each with its own unique characteristics. These styles include seal script, clerical script, regular script, running script, and cursive script. Each style has its own rules and techniques, and mastering them takes years of practice.Chinese calligraphy is a beautiful art form that reflects the elegance and beauty of Chinese culture. It is a way for us to connect with our cultural heritage and appreciate the rich history of China.3. Traditional Chinese MedicineTraditional Chinese medicine is a system of medicine that has been practiced for thousands of years in China. It is based on the belief that the human body is a complex system that can be balanced and harmonized through various treatments.One of the key components of traditional Chinese medicine is acupuncture, which involves inserting thin needles into specific points on the body. Acupuncture is believed to stimulate the body's natural healing processes and promote overall health and wellbeing.Another important aspect of traditional Chinese medicine is herbal medicine. Chinese herbs are used to treat a wide range of conditions, from the common cold to more serious illnesses. These herbs are often combined in formulas that are tailored to the individual's specific needs.Traditional Chinese medicine also includes other therapies such as cupping, moxibustion, and massage. These therapies are believed to promote circulation, relieve pain, and improve overall health.Traditional Chinese medicine has gained worldwide recognition for its effectiveness in treating a wide range of conditions. It is a valuable part of China's cultural heritage and a testament to the ingenuity and wisdom of the Chinese people.4. The Chinese ZodiacThe Chinese zodiac is a system of astrology that has been used in China for thousands of years. It is based on a twelve-year cycle, with each year represented by an animal. The animals of the zodiac are the rat, ox, tiger, rabbit, dragon, snake,horse, sheep, monkey, rooster, dog, and pig.Each animal of the zodiac is believed to have certain characteristics and traits that influence the year in which they are represented. For example, people born in the year of the rat are believed to be clever and resourceful, while those born in the year of the dragon are believed to be strong and powerful.The Chinese zodiac is not just a system of astrology, but also a way to understand and appreciate Chinese culture. It is a reflection of the Chinese people's belief in the cyclical nature of time and the importance of harmony and balance in life.The Chinese zodiac is still widely used in China today, and is a way for people to connect with their cultural heritage and appreciate the wisdom and insight of the Chinese people.。

Through the preservation and study of these palaces, we can gain a deeper understanding of Chinese history, culture, and architecture.范文五:传统乐器-古筝Chinese traditional culture is known for its rich musical heritage, and one of the most iconic musical instruments is the Guzheng. The Guzheng, also known as the Chinese zither, has a history of over 2,500 years and is deeply rooted in Chinese culture.The Guzheng is a plucked string instrument with movable bridges and 21 or more strings. It is played by plucking the strings with the right hand and pressing the strings with the left hand to create different pitches and tones. The sound of the Guzheng is ethereal and melodious, evoking a sense of tranquility and elegance.The Guzheng is not only a musical instrument but also a medium for artistic expression. It is often used to perform traditional Chinese music, such as classical and folk tunes, as well as modern compositions. The melodies played on the Guzheng can convey a wide range of emotions and tell stories, reflecting the richcultural traditions and values of the Chinese people.In recent years, there has been a renewed interest in the Guzheng, both in China and internationally. Many young people are learning to play the instrument, attending classes and participating in competitions. The popularity of the Guzheng not only helps to preserve and promote traditional Chinese music but also provides a platform for cultural exchange and appreciation.The Guzheng is not just a musical instrument; it is a symbol of Chinese identity and heritage. Through learning and playing the Guzheng, we can connect with our cultural roots, appreciate the beauty of traditional Chinese music, and pass on our traditions and values to future generations.。
